Freescale 8bit Microcontroller with SmartMOS

Freescale 8bit Microcontroller with SmartMOS

Freescale has an interesting product line: embedded MCU plus power, MM908Exxx. It is a combination of analog features such as high side and low side switches, H-bridge stepper motor drivers using SMARTMOS technologies with Freescale standard flash microcontroller (HC08/HC12) in a single package.
